Quotes about caution
1. The head should be cold but warm. Japan
2. When doing great things, you must be careful about the beginning and the end. Book of Rites
3. A cautious person has eyes in the back of his head. William Robertson
4. A cautious scientist neither makes mistakes nor makes discoveries. UK
5. Words set an example for the world, and actions lead a scholar. Liu Yi Qingshi of the Southern Song Dynasty said a new saying
6. Birds look three times before flying, and people think three times before flying. China
7. However, no sword is single-edged. Every sword has double edges. If one side hurts someone, the other side will hurt yourself. Victor Hugo's Les Miserables
8. Don't just say whatever comes to mind, think twice before doing anything. Shakespeare's Hamlet
9. If you don't cherish it when you use it, it will be damaged; if you don't do it carefully, you will fail. Mongolian
10. An ounce of care is worth a pound of knowledge. UK
11. Measure three times before you cut. Italy
12. Success often occurs when you are in poverty, and failure often occurs when you are successful. China
13. It is better to be cautious beforehand than to make amends afterwards. One Love One Cork
14. Be firm on hard days and cautious on smooth days. Mongolia
15. It is always good to be extra careful. France
16. I would rather run into obstacles in broad daylight with my short talent than be saved or get rich in the dark with caution. Lametri
17. Be careful in your words and careful in your deeds. Book of Rites, Managing Clothes
18. Words and actions are like playing chess, one move means three moves. China
19. Caution is part of bravery. Spain
20. If you act prudently, you can strengthen your ambition, and if you speak prudently, you can uphold your virtues. Hu Hong, the beard of Song Dynasty, knows the words of King Wen

Famous aphorisms for making friends with caution
Famous aphorisms for making friends with caution
1. Just as true gold must be recognized in fire, friendship must withstand the test of adversity. Ovid
2. The best way to deal with the fear of external enemies is to make as many friends as possible; for those who cannot be friends, at least avoid making grudges with them; if you can't even do this If you do, you should try your best to avoid interacting with them and alienate them for your own benefit. Epicurean
3. First light and then thick, first sparse and then dense, first far and then close, this is the way to make friends. Hu's family motto
4. You don't need to pay attention when talking to your friends, but when you are facing an enemy, you must always be on guard. Lu Xun
5. Sincere friendship seems to be healthy. Only when it is lost do you realize how valuable it is.
Cordon
6. Never fall into pride. Because when you are proud, you will reject other people's advice and the help of friendship; because when you are proud, you will be stubborn when you should agree; because when you are proud, you will lose the objective criterion. Pavlov
7. A good friend is often gained in adversity.
8. When making friends, you must choose the one who is better than yourself. It is beneficial to talk about it thoroughly and discuss it. Those who are arrogant, disrespectful, and lead others to do evil will harm their friends. A gentleman and a gentleman are friends who share the same path; a gentleman and a gentleman are friends who share the same interests. When making friends, only take advantage of their strengths and ignore their shortcomings.
